Psalms Chapter 53 (NASB)
1 [420][421] The fool has said in his heart, “There is no God.” They are corrupt, and have committed abominable injustice; There is no one who does good.
2 God has looked down from heaven upon the sons of mankind To see if there is anyone who [422]understands, Who seeks after God.
3 Every one of them has turned aside; together they have become corrupt; There is no one who does good, not even one.
4 Have the workers of injustice no knowledge, Who eat up My people like they ate bread, And have not called upon God?
5 They were in great [423]fear there, where no [424]fear had been; For God scattered the bones of [425]him who encamped against you; You put them to shame, because God had rejected them.
6 Oh, that the salvation of Israel would come from Zion! When God restores the fortunes of His people, Jacob shall rejoice, Israel shall be glad.
